Troops of the Nigerian Army have foiled an attempt by suspected terrorists to block a major highway in Kebbi State during a security operation.
Military authorities said the troops engaged the armed group, forcing the suspects to flee the scene before they could carry out their planned attack.
During the operation, soldiers recovered two motorcycles believed to have been used by the fleeing suspects.
The military said troops have intensified patrols and clearance operations in the area to prevent further attacks and ensure the safety of commuters.
It reaffirmed its commitment to sustaining offensive operations against criminal elements and restoring security across affected communities.
